Benefits of Using a Tiles Clean Brush

A tiles clean brush offers numerous advantages when it comes to cleaning your tiled surfaces. Here are some key benefits:

  • Effective Cleaning: Tiles clean brushes are designed to reach into the grout and crevices of tiles, ensuring a thorough clean.
  • Time-Saving: With the right brush, you can clean large areas quickly and efficiently, reducing the time spent on cleaning tasks.
  • Versatility: Many tiles clean brushes can be used on various surfaces, including ceramic, porcelain, and stone tiles.
  • Eco-Friendly: By using a brush, you can reduce the need for harsh chemicals, making it a more environmentally friendly cleaning option.

Types of Tiles Clean Brushes

Understanding the different types of tiles clean brushes can help you make an informed choice. Here are some common varieties:

1. Handheld Brushes

Handheld tiles clean brushes are small and easy to maneuver, making them ideal for spot cleaning and getting into tight spaces.

2. Electric Brushes

Electric tiles clean brushes provide more power and speed, making them suitable for larger areas or heavily soiled tiles.

3. Grout Brushes

Grout brushes have stiff bristles designed specifically to tackle the grime that builds up in grout lines.

4. Scrub Brushes

Scrub brushes are versatile tools that can be used for various cleaning tasks, including tiles, countertops, and floors.

How to Choose the Right Tiles Clean Brush

Selecting the right tiles clean brush is crucial for achieving optimal cleaning results. Consider the following factors:

  • Material: Choose brushes with durable bristles that can withstand rigorous scrubbing.
  • Size: Ensure the brush size is appropriate for the area you intend to clean.
  • Handle Design: Look for ergonomic handles that provide a comfortable grip.
  • Compatibility: Ensure the brush is suitable for the type of tiles you have.

Techniques for Using a Tiles Clean Brush

To get the best results from your tiles clean brush, follow these techniques:

  • Preparation: Remove loose debris and dirt from the tiles before starting.
  • Use Cleaning Solution: Apply an appropriate cleaning solution to the tiles to loosen dirt.
  • Scrubbing Technique: Use circular motions to scrub the tiles, ensuring you cover all areas.
  • Rinse: After scrubbing, rinse the tiles with clean water to remove any residue.

Maintaining Your Tiles Clean Brush

Proper maintenance of your tiles clean brush will extend its lifespan and effectiveness. Follow these tips:

  • Clean After Use: Rinse the brush thoroughly to remove any debris and cleaning solution.
  • Store Properly: Keep the brush in a dry place to prevent mold or mildew growth.
  • Inspect Regularly: Check for worn or damaged bristles and replace the brush as needed.

Common Issues and Solutions

Even with the best tools, you may encounter challenges while cleaning tiles. Here are some common issues and their solutions:

  • Stubborn Stains: Use a stronger cleaning solution or a different brush type to tackle tough stains.
  • Brush Damage: Replace the brush if the bristles are fraying or breaking.
  • Grout Discoloration: Consider using a grout cleaner or whitening agent specifically designed for grout.

Safety Tips for Using Tiles Clean Brushes

While cleaning tiles, it's essential to keep safety in mind. Here are some tips:

  • Wear Gloves: Protect your hands from cleaning chemicals and grime.
  • Follow Instructions: Always read and follow the manufacturer's instructions for cleaning solutions and brushes.
  • Ensure Adequate Ventilation: When using chemical cleaners, work in a well-ventilated area to avoid inhaling fumes.
